Mirror's Edge is a single-player first-person action-adventure video game developed by DICE (Battlefield series) and published by Electronic Arts. It takes place in an utopian city and the player controls Faith, a "Runner" who finds herself on the wrong side of the law.
The following weapons appear in the video game Mirror's Edge:
The Colt M1911A1 pistol appears in the game as the main weapon of the CPF officers. Ropeburn has one lying on his desk in Chapter 4, "Heat". Two nickel plated versions are used by Miller. The M1911A1 is incorrectly portrayed to be a DAO pistol.
The Glock 18C can be found in Chapter 6, "Pirandello Kruger", when a CPF officer opens a door and fires at the player. Has a two stage trigger, firing in three-round bursts with a short pull of the trigger, or full-auto if it is held down. Holds 24 rounds. It was also originally planned to be Faith's personal weapon. This weapon is also seen in one of the loading screens, where Faith is seen disarming a trooper and dropping his gun, which has the extended 33-round magazine.
The NeoStead 2000 combat shotgun is seen being used by some PK security members. It is not very powerful and may require to hit the target as many as three times before they go down.

An unlockable concept art image shows Faith neutralizing a guard holding a Heckler & Koch MP5SD3 submachine gun.

Note that while the selector marking cannot be seen clearly, the SEF receiver is evident, indicacting that it can only be an SD3.
Steyr TMP
The Steyr TMP is used by armored CPF officers. This is one of the less common guns in the game.
The First Generation FN SCAR-L CQC in black finish is used by most PK security members who don't have G36C's later in the game. For some reason, this rifle's rear sight is always flipped down, which would make it very hard if not impossible to aim accurately.
The FN M249 Paratrooper light machine gun is used by PK security members. In most large groups of troopers (4 or more), there is usually at least one carrying an M249. This is the heaviest gun in the game, and it makes Faith move very slowly.
